How To Fix FVD_CHARGE047 - Activation of charges was simulated successfully


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FVD_CHARGE -

  • Message number: 047

  • Message text: Activation of charges was simulated successfully

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message FVD_CHARGE047 - Activation of charges was simulated successfully ?

    The SAP error message FVD_CHARGE047 indicates that the activation of charges was simulated successfully, but it does not necessarily mean that there is an error. Instead, it suggests that the system has performed a simulation of the charge activation process, and the results of that simulation are available for review.

    Cause:

    1. Simulation Mode: The message is typically generated when the system is in simulation mode, meaning that it is not actually executing the charge activation but rather showing what would happen if it were to proceed.
    2. Configuration Settings: The system may be configured to run in simulation mode for testing purposes, which is common during development or testing phases.
    3. User Action: The user may have explicitly requested a simulation instead of an actual execution.

    Solution:

    1. Check Simulation Settings: If you intended to activate charges rather than simulate them, check the settings or parameters you are using to ensure that you are not in simulation mode.
    2. Review Simulation Results: If you are in simulation mode for a reason (e.g., testing), review the results provided by the simulation to ensure that they meet your expectations.
    3. Execute Actual Activation: If you want to proceed with the actual activation of charges, ensure that you select the appropriate option in the transaction or program you are using to perform the activation.
    4. Consult Documentation: Refer to the SAP documentation or help resources for the specific transaction or program you are using to understand how to switch from simulation to actual execution.
